We created one overview dashboard and linked another dashboard which contains two dashlets one for transaction flow and another for host monitoring overview(perfmon parameters)
Now when from 1st dashboard we will go to linked dashboard ideally filter should get applied to both the dashlets but in my case filter gets applied to only transaction flow dashlets not for host monitoring dashlets.

Jalpesh,
it simply doesn't make sense to apply a transaction based filter (in your case the business transaction filter) to metrics that are not transaction based (the monitoring plugin metrics). This would be like selecting green apples out of a box that only contains brown bottles - it would give you nothing because they have nothing in common at all.
